## Deploying the Gatewick Proctor Queue

Deploys are pretty painless: push to main, wait for the pipeline, then watch the queue drain dashboard for five minutes. If candidates pile up mid-exam, roll back first and ask questions later — the queue replays safely. Everything the workers care about lives in one config block, shown here for reference.

settings of bafof-yagef:
JOROX_PIN=8740
JOROX_TENANT=pelox
JOROX_METRICS_HOST=metrics.jorox.qorvelworks.internal
JOROX_SEAL=seal_c78f63c1
JOROX_STANDBY_TEAM=norax

Handover: Bulk edits in the Ledgertray admin table

For whoever picks this up — bulk edits are half-migrated to the async path. Edits under 50 rows still apply synchronously; larger batches go through the job runner, and partial failures roll back per-chunk, not per-batch. New folks: read the chunking notes before touching validation. The job runner currently uses the configuration values below.

service settings:
PRAIX_LOG_LEVEL=error
PRAIX_METRICS_HOST=metrics.praix.qorvelcorp.corp
PRAIX_POOL_SIZE=16

Subject: On-call heads-up — Orchardly catalog cache. Welcome aboard. The main gotcha: catalog price updates invalidate by SKU, but bundle pages cache composite keys, so a stale bundle can outlive its parts. If support reports wrong bundle prices, purge the composite namespace first. We'll cover this at the weekly sync; the invalidation playbook is on this internal page.

wiki page, yagef-tawif: https://sentry.lumicdata.local/view/merge_requests/pipeline/merge_requests/e08f7f35c80b5755

Water Sample Transport — Corven Reservoir. Samples drawn by the Ledgate Hydrology team are bottled, chilled, and boxed at the pump house before noon each sampling day. Dispatch must book a same-day run to the Brindmoor testing lab, keeping boxes upright and out of direct sun. Chain-of-custody forms travel inside the lid pocket. The confidential hand-over instruction for the courier appears below.

handover note for yagef-bagep: the drudor pelius courier leaves the kasdor zorvan norir ledger at gate 8016 under passcode 755406